The number of inches you can lose with liposuction varies based on several factors, including the amount of fat removed, the specific areas treated, and your individual body composition.
Typically, liposuction can remove several pounds of fat, which can translate to a noticeable reduction in inches. For instance, removing a liter of fat can result in a reduction of about 2.2 pounds, which can significantly slim down the treated areas. However, it's important to note that liposuction is not a weight loss solution but rather a contouring procedure.
The results can be quite dramatic, especially in areas like the abdomen, thighs, and hips, where fat tends to accumulate. Patients often see a reduction in clothing sizes and an improvement in body shape. However, the exact number of inches lost can vary from person to person.

Expected Outcomes
While it's challenging to provide an exact number of inches lost, many patients report noticeable changes in their body measurements. For instance, in the abdomen, patients might lose anywhere from 2 to 6 inches, depending on the individual case. Similarly, in the thighs, a reduction of 1 to 4 inches is common. These figures are approximate and can vary.
Post-Operative Considerations
It's also essential to consider that the final results of liposuction may not be immediately apparent. Swelling and bruising are common post-operative effects that can mask the true contouring results. Full results typically become visible within a few months as the swelling subsides and the body heals.

Factors Influencing Liposuction Outcomes
Firstly, the amount of fat removed during liposuction is typically measured in cubic centimeters rather than inches. However, to provide a general idea, a typical liposuction procedure can remove between 500 to 5,000 cubic centimeters of fat, depending on the patient's goals and the surgeon's recommendations. This can translate to a noticeable reduction in circumference, often measured in inches.

Maintaining Results
To maintain the results of your liposuction, a healthy lifestyle is crucial. This includes maintaining a balanced diet and engaging in regular physical activity. While liposuction can remove stubborn fat, it does not prevent future weight gain. Therefore, ongoing commitment to health and wellness is essential for long-lasting results.
